Abstract Thick laminates are increasingly present in large composites structures such as wind turbine blades. Different factors are suspected to be involved in the decreased static and dynamic performance of thick laminates. These include the effect of self-heating, the scaling effect, and the manufacturing process influence. The aim of this work is to study the through thickness variation of static and dynamic lamina properties in thick laminates. For this purpose, 60-70 mm thick unidirectional GFRP/epoxy infused panels were divided in sub-laminates with the help of peel-ply layers at different thickness positions. From each sub-laminate, 4 mm thick compression coupons with integrated tabs and tension coupons were manufactured. In order to characterize the manufacturing influence, the 60-70 mm thick laminates plates were monitored during the manufacturing. Static and fatigue tests were carried out for each sub-laminate in order to study the lamina properties at different thicknesses positions through the thickness. The present work reports temperature profiles and residual stress measurements through the thickness recorded during the manufacturing, as well as experimental data from static and fatigue tests (S-N curves) of sub-laminates obtained at different thickness positions.
